Skeletal remains believed to be of missing Manchester man found

Published:Monday | July 1, 2024 | 1:04 PM
An autopsy is to be conducted on the remains for identification purposes.

The Manchester police are now trying to ascertain if skeletal remains found in a yard belong to a man who was reported missing last September.

The discovery was made on Sunday afternoon.

The remains are believed to be that of 52-year-old Delroy Carter of Duncaster district in Mile Gully.

The remains were found at the rear of the man's premises about 4:40.

It was retrieved and removed for storage and for an autopsy to be done for identification purposes.

Carter, who is said to be of an unsound mind, was reported missing in September 2023.
